Check Digit Verification of cas no

The CAS Registry Mumber 1198613-79-4 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,1,9,8,6,1 and 3 respectively; the second part has 2 digits, 7 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 1198613-79:
(9*1)+(8*1)+(7*9)+(6*8)+(5*6)+(4*1)+(3*3)+(2*7)+(1*9)=194
194 % 10 = 4
So 1198613-79-4 is a valid CAS Registry Number.

Base-Induced Highly Regioselective Synthesis of N2-Substituted 1,2,3-Triazoles under Mild Conditions in Air

Ji, Jian,Guan, Cong,Wei, Qinghua,Chen, Xuwen,Zhao, Yun,Liu, Shunying

supporting information, p. 132 - 136 (2022/01/04)

We developed a highly regioselective base-induced synthesis of N2-substituted 1,2,3-triazoles from N-sulfonyl-1,2,3-triazoles and alkyl bromides/alkyl iodides at room temperature. We propose an SN2-like mechanistic pathway to explain the high N2-regioselectivity. The protocol features a broad substrate scope and generates products in good to excellent yields (72–90%).

Ruthenium-Catalyzed meta-Selective C?H Nitration of Biologically Important Aryltetrazoles

Chen, Jian,Huang, Tianle,Gong, Xinrui,Yu, Zhu-Jun,Shi, Yuesen,Yan, Yu-Hang,Zheng, Yang,Liu, Xuexin,Li, Guo-Bo,Wu, Yong

supporting information, p. 2984 - 2989 (2020/06/08)

The first example of tetrazole-directed meta-selective C?H nitration is described. This transformation provided a straightforward approach for the synthesis of biologically important m-nitroaryltetrazoles in moderate to excellent yields with good functional group compatibility. In addition, new metallo-β-lactamase inhibitors were obtained by further transformation of the synthesized m-nitroaryltetrazoles. (Figure presented.).

Rational design of 4-aryl-1,2,3-triazoles for indoleamine 2,3-dioxygenase 1 inhibition

R?hrig, Ute F.,Majjigapu, Somi Reddy,Grosdidier, Aurélien,Bron, Sylvian,Stroobant, Vincent,Pilotte, Luc,Colau, Didier,Vogel, Pierre,Van Den Eynde, Beno?t J.,Zoete, Vincent,Michielin, Olivier

, p. 5270 - 5290 (2012/08/28)

Indoleamine 2,3-dioxygenase 1 (IDO1) is an important therapeutic target for the treatment of diseases such as cancer that involve pathological immune escape. Starting from the scaffold of our previously discovered IDO1 inhibitor 4-phenyl-1,2,3-triazole, we used computational structure-based methods to design more potent ligands. This approach yielded highly efficient low molecular weight inhibitors, the most active being of nanomolar potency both in an enzymatic and in a cellular assay, while showing no cellular toxicity and a high selectivity for IDO1 over tryptophan 2,3-dioxygenase (TDO). A quantitative structure-activity relationship based on the electrostatic ligand-protein interactions in the docked binding modes and on the quantum chemically derived charges of the triazole ring demonstrated a good explanatory power for the observed activities.

General solution to the synthesis of N-2-substituted 1,2,3-triazoles

Wang, Xiao-Jun,Zhang, Li,Krishnamurthy, Dhileepkumar,Senanayake, Chris H.,Wipf, Peter

scheme or table, p. 4632 - 4635 (2010/12/18)

The regioselective N-alkylation of 1,2,3-triazoles 1 - 6 was studied. Good to excellent N-2 selectivity and high chemical yields for N-2-substituted 4,5-dibromotriazoles 7 were obtained with 4,5-dibromo- and 4-bromo-5- trimethylsilyl-1,2,3-triazoles. These building blocks can be readily converted to 2-mono-, 2,4-di-, and 2,4,5-polysubstituted triazoles 10 - 15, providing a general, protective, group-free method for the synthesis of N-2-substituted triazoles. Observed regioselectivities can be rationalized by a combination of Frontier Molecular Orbital, steric, and electrostatic directing effects on the heterocyclic scaffolds.

Bromo-directed N-2 alkylation of NH-1,2,3-triazoles: Efficient synthesis of poly-substituted 1,2,3-triazoles

Wang, Xiao-Jun,Sidhu, Kanwar,Zhang, Li,Campbell, Scot,Haddad, Nizar,Reeves, Diana C.,Krishnamurthy, Dhileepkumar,Senanayake, Chris H.

supporting information; experimental part, p. 5490 - 5493 (2010/02/28)

"Chemical Equation Presented" Reaction of 4-bromo-NH-1,2,3- triazoles 2 with alkyl halides In the presence of K2CO3 in DMF produced the corresponding 2-substituted 4-bromo1,2,3-triazoles 5 In a regioselective process. Subsequent Suzuki cross-coupling reaction of these bromides provided an efficient synthesis of 2,4,5-trisubstituted triazoles 3. In addition, reduction of the bromotriazoles by hydrogenation furnished an efficient synthesis of 2,4-disubstituted triazoles 8.
